ISO 9001 - Quality Management Systems

This two-day seminar will help participants understand that ISO 9001 is a business structure that can help to achieve strategic goals and objectives. This quality system provides the core structure of brining in and satisfying contracts. Linking the process steps well will ensure ongoing profitability of any company. Effective management involvement is crucial in obtaining business effectiveness.
